site stats

Thumb mode and arm mode

WebApr 12, 2024 · Finally, there are some bug fixes and improvements. For example, Microsoft is updating the Linux kernel version to 5.15.78 and making changes to improve platform reliability. WebNov 4, 2016 · An ARM object file should contain symbols identifying the regions that are arm code ( $a ), thumb code ( $t) and literal data ( $d ). You can see these as symbols #4 and …

4K Toy E58 Drone WIFI FPV With Wide Angle Camera Hold Arm

WebJan 19, 2011 · Since the instruction is cbz the compilation should be in thum mode. how can i modify my make file and how can i switch the mode from ARM to thumb for execute the optimized instruction. please let me know the mode change needs any extra cycle. Rgds Dave Oldest Newest Offline Dave Mathew over 9 years ago Offline Dave Mathew over 9 … WebIf the compiler can produce THUMB code in fewer instructions it will, but if ARM results in fewer instructions you get ARM. This is the default mode for Keil, if I recall correctly. ... how do sore throats start https://pineleric.com

Mode von Heine Damen Kleid Rundhals Knielang 3/4-Arm …

WebJun 1, 2012 · The ARM core can only run instructions on even addresses. The core masks off the least significant bit of an address and uses it to detremine the instruction set it is running in. So to jump to a bootloader address and stay in thumb mode, you must add 1 to the destination address. WebMar 10, 2024 · A program is compiled without -marm (defaults to thumb mode) An assembly section of that program uses ARM mode; I tried compiling a small test program on Raspberry Pi 4 with Ubuntu 18.04.4 kernel 5.3.0-1018-raspi2 and noticed that the .arm section is being executed in 16-bit thumb instruction mode which prompted me to … http://www.icetech.com/appnotes/arm-thumb.pdf how do sorting machines work

Documentation – Arm Developer - ARM architecture family

Category:How does an ARM processor in thumb state execute 32 …

Tags:Thumb mode and arm mode

Thumb mode and arm mode

Arm Alphanumeric Shellcode · The Plain Text - GitHub Pages

Web자자, ARM mode와 THUMB mode에 관한 얘기를 했고, 이 차이에 대해서는 ARM 구현 쪽에서 . ... R12 (IP, Intra..) : ARM-Thumb interworking등에 또는 long branch시에 Veneer를 통해 주소 할당 시에 임시 보관소로 사용함. (음.. 어렵죠.. 이건 Veneer를 이해하면 좀 쉬울 거에요.) Webto return to ARM or Thumb caller: BX lr ; replaces MOV pc, lr Subroutine calls later ARMs support BLX instruction to synthesize BLX or earlier ARM: ADR r0, subr + 1 ; “+ 1” to enter Thumb mode ADR lr, return ; save return address BX r0 ; calls subr return ...

Thumb mode and arm mode

Did you know?

WebThumb mode is a mode of the ARM processor that uses less power and runs smaller code: in this video we figure out why and how to use it! Learn how to use Thu...

WebJazelle DBX (Direct Bytecode eXecution) is a technique that allows Java bytecode to be executed directly in the ARM architecture as a third execution state (and instruction set) alongside the existing ARM and Thumb-mode. Support for this state is signified by the "J" in the ARMv5TEJ architecture, and in ARM9EJ-S and ARM7EJ-S core names. WebJan 30, 2024 · The tiarmclang compiler also supports Arm Cortex-R type processor variants, Cortex-R4 and Cortex-R5, which can execute ARM and T32 THUMB instructions. By default, the tiarmclang compiler will assume ARM instruction mode, but the user can instruct the compiler to assume the use of T32 THUMB instructions for a given compilation by …

WebObjectives To understand 16-bit Wrist state operation by RAIL Processor. To understand who features of Thumb state how and select Thumb instruction decompress to ARM Mode. Till know the technical are switching between ARM also Thumbnail mode of operations. To get the similarities and disparities between ARM and Thumb method of handling Till … WebSep 12, 2009 · 一般來說, 對於同一份C程式, 分別編譯為ARM mode及Thumb mode, 有下列差異: Thumb mode的code size為ARM mode的70%. Thumb mode需要使用的指令比ARM mode多40%以上. 在32位元的記憶體架構下, ARM mode的code比Thumb mode的code快40%. 在16位元的記憶體架構下, Thumb mode的code比ARM mode的code快45% ...

WebFeb 22, 2015 · Thumb2 32-bit instructions have a different encoding than their ARM mode equivalent. Thinking of Thumb2 as including actual ARM instructions might be a useful …

WebJun 22, 2016 · This is the meaning of Thumb instructions are 16 bits long,and have a corresponding 32-bit ARM instruction that has the same effect on processor model. … how much should a 17 week old puppy sleepWeb* [PATCH][ARM,ifcvt] Improve use of conditional execution in thumb mode. @ 2012-02-14 17:00 Andrew Stubbs 2012-02-14 17:32 ` Richard Earnshaw 0 siblings, 1 reply; 12+ messages in thread From: Andrew Stubbs @ 2012-02-14 17:00 UTC (permalink / raw) To: gcc-patches; +Cc: patches [-- Attachment #1: Type: text/plain, Size: 1572 bytes --] Hi all, I ... how much should a 18 month old weighhttp://recipes.egloos.com/4988629 how do soul reapers dieWebJan 31, 2024 · The ARM processor can manipulate 32 bit values because it is a 32-bit processor, whatever mode it is running in (Thumb or ARM). It just means its registers are … how do soul reapers ageWebARM Processor Modes and Registers The ARM architecture is a modal architecture. Before the introduction of Security Extensions it had seven processor modes, summarized in Table 3-1 . There were six privileged modes and a non-privileged user mode. Privilegeis the ability to perform certain tasks that cannot be done from User (Unprivileged)mode. how much should a 19 month old girl weighWebApr 12, 2024 · Less noise, deeper immersion: ROG Destrier Ergo Gaming Chair with futuristic cyborg aesthetic, versatile seat adjustments for the perfect posture, mobile gaming arm support mode, and acoustic panel for less distraction and deeper gaming immersion. how do soul eggs workWebMar 15, 2024 · So we will first jump to thumb mode change the code , set the correct register values to flash the cache then jump to arm mode flush the cache change to thumb mode set “/bin/sh” and call execve syscall . This is the finished shellcode , It is … how much should a 17 year old weigh in kg